About
"Bakumatsu Renka Shinsengumi," released in 2021, is an engaging adventure game that uniquely combines romance and historical battles, focusing on female empowerment. Players take on the role of the first female soldier in the Shinsengumi, navigating love and conflict alongside iconic figures like Kondo, Hijikata, and Okita. This narrative-driven gameplay offers a fresh take on the genre, appealing to fans of historical fiction and romance.
